I am grateful for this additional opportunity to stress again my support for the Hawaii County Band and to urge you all once more to consider very carefully what the band's real value is to Hawaii County. There is no price that can equal what the band has contributed to this County's historic and cultural history. Since its founding in 1883, thousands of people - residents and visitors alike - have been the benefactors of what the County Band has provided for 127 years. Hundreds of descendants of Jules and Joaquin Carvalho, the founding brothers of the band, and of their sister Margareda and brother Virginio have always taken immense pride in knowing that their ancestors made such a tremendous contribution to the betterment of life on the Big Island. From its humble beginnings, the County Band has blossomed into a superior musical organization the likes of which are rarely found in other municipalities. To now discard it as a non - essential burden on the County's budget would be to ignore that continuing contribution. The County Band is an entity of which all residents of this county can be proud. I sincerely hope you all share in that pride and will do whatever is necessary to preserve this valuable living treasure. Mahelo! Urban F.
